Amy Sitapati, MD is a highly experienced primary care physician and professor of medicine based in San Diego, CA. With over ten years of expertise in providing patient-centered care, Dr. Sitapati specializes in preventive care, acute and chronic disease diagnosis and treatment, and gender-affirming care for transgender and nonbinary patients. She is nationally recognized for her work in primary care and is committed to building multidisciplinary teams that prioritize patient care coordination and empowerment. Dr. Sitapati combines evidence-based medicine with patient empowerment, prevention methods, and alternative medicine to help patients achieve optimal health.
Dr. Sitapati's dedication to humanistic medicine has earned her the Leonard Tow Humanism in Medicine Award in 2022. She is a professor of medicine, clinical researcher, and instructor for medical students and residents. Dr. Sitapati completed her medical degree at Case Western Reserve University and her residency training at UC San Diego School of Medicine. She is board certified in internal medicine and clinical informatics, and her clinical research focuses on patient-centered care, quality improvement, and meditation. Dr. Sitapati is committed to delivering high-quality, integrated care that emphasizes patient empowerment and a balanced approach to health.
